Cysteine Redox State Governs the Condensation Pathway of Hendra Virus W Protein and Differentially Impacts Type I IFN and NF‐κB Signaling

open access: yesAdvanced Science, EarlyView.
The cysteine redox state of the Hendra virus W (WHeV) protein controls assembly into fibrils or amorphous aggregates, with residues 2–29 required for fibrillation. In cells, WHeV forms different types of nuclear condensates. Impaired ability to form redox‐sensitive, non‐filamentous condensates reduces WHeV inhibition of the NF‐κB pathway, while it ...

Overcoming Artificial Structures in Resolution‐Enhanced Hi‐C Data by Signal Decomposition and Multi‐Scale Attention

open access: yesAdvanced Science, EarlyView.
Deep‐learning‐based signal enhancement is an effective way to recover high‐resolution details from a low‐resolution chromatin contact map. However, due to computational challenges, existing methods commonly divide up the contact map into small patches and create artificial discontinuities at patch boundaries.
